linux下jenkins的安装,各种插件安装,jdk,maven,git的配置,项目打包的构建测试
1、下载
点击下载的地址
这个war包在Windows和Linux是通用的,所以下载这个就行。
2、启动
方式一:通过后台方式启动Jenkins,命令如下:
#启动命令
nohup java -jar /usr/local/soft/jenkins/jenkins.war --httpPort=8899 >/usr/local/soft/jenkins/jenkins.log 2>&1 &
其中,/usr/local/soft/jenkins是存放 war包 的路径,
httpPort=8899是当前指定访问的端口。
方式二:也可以将war包放到tomcat中,启动tomcat即可。
3、访问
地址:http://ip+端口号
如果输入地址后不能访问,则需要开通端口
#8899为端口
iptables -I INPUT -p tcp -m state --state NEW -m tcp --dport 8899 -j ACCEPT
#保存iptables规则
service iptables save
正常访问结果:
根据界面的提示,到路径/root/.jenkins/secrets/initialAdminPassword下找出密码,然后复制填入即可。
[aaa@qq.com jenkins]# cat /root/.jenkins/secrets/initialAdminPassword
2b11eb0324e64026891233267c575bd9
[aaa@qq.com jenkins]#
4、插件下载,汉化
在插件管理中搜索Localization
插件下载地址:
1、 https://wiki.jenkins-ci.org/display/JENKINS/Plugins ;
2、https://mirrors.tuna.tsinghua.edu.cn/jenkins/plugins/
插件可以自行下载,然后将插件再上传到jenkins上即可。
搜索并点击进去
然后点击右上角的下载。
下载后,进入页面中插件管理
将下载后的插件上传即可。
5、安装git插件
安装失败,是因为缺少这些依赖的插件,依次安装即可,
可能会有好多坑,不过具体就看错误的日志,缺少哪个依赖就下载并上传哪个就可以,注意版本的要求,插件安装后最好重启一下jenkins。
安装成功后的效果:
6、配置maven
这里要配置maven的配置文件settings.xml的地址。
maven的配置文件settings.xml要记得修改,配置成阿里的镜像地址即可,
<mirrors>
<mirror>
<id>alimaven</id>
<mirrorOf>central</mirrorOf>
<name>aliyun maven</name>
<url>https://maven.aliyun.com/repository/central</url>
</mirror>
<mirror>
<id>aliyun-maven</id>
<mirrorOf>*</mirrorOf>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public</url>
</mirror>
</mirrors>
这里配置maven的安装路径。
7、配置jdk
配置jdk的安装目录
8、配置git
先查看下git的安装目录。
然后再配置git的安装目录。
9、创建job
第一步,创建任务名称
自行起名字就可
第二步,源码管理,填写git的地址和账号密码
第三步,构建的配置
暂时测试一下maven打包;
目标位置就是填写maven的执行命令。
第四步,执行构建
点击刚才创建的任务,点击执行Build Now
然后可以查看构建的状态,点击控制台输出,具体可以看构建的实时日志。
成功后的结果